In the food and medical sectors, polyolefin synthetic pulp plays a crucial role due to its chemical inertness, high strength, and excellent barrier properties. In food packaging, polyolefin synthetic pulp is used to create protective layers that ensure product freshness and prevent contamination. The material's non-toxic nature and resistance to moisture make it an ideal choice for medical applications such as disposable wipes, surgical drapes, and sterilized medical packaging. The rising demand for hygienic and safe products in these sectors, along with increased consumer health awareness, is driving the growth of polyolefin synthetic pulp in food and medical applications. Furthermore, the pulp's versatility in providing robust, lightweight, and customizable solutions makes it indispensable in these industries.For the medical industry, polyolefin synthetic pulp offers significant advantages, such as the ability to be sterilized without losing structural integrity. Its potential use in creating packaging for pharmaceuticals, medical instruments, and even protective clothing ensures the material's continued importance. The rising demand for healthcare products and stringent regulations governing medical packaging ensure that the role of polyolefin synthetic pulp in these applications will continue to expand. As global health standards evolve, the material's reliability and ability to meet stringent regulatory requirements will cement its position in the food and medical markets.

Polyolefin synthetic pulp's exceptional printability and flexibility make it a preferred material in the labels and cards segment. In the labeling industry, synthetic pulp is used to create durable, high-quality labels that can withstand extreme environmental conditions, including exposure to moisture, sunlight, and abrasions. The pulp's ability to maintain its structural integrity when exposed to these elements makes it ideal for a wide range of applications, including product labeling, logistics, and branding. Moreover, its compatibility with various printing technologies, including digital and screen printing, ensures that it can deliver clear and consistent designs on all types of labels.In the cards industry, polyolefin synthetic pulp is increasingly used in the production of credit cards, identification cards, and loyalty cards. The material offers enhanced durability and resistance to wear and tear compared to traditional paper-based products. Additionally, the ability to incorporate security features, such as holograms or UV markings, into the pulp adds value and functionality. As businesses continue to prioritize the need for longer-lasting, visually appealing, and secure labels and cards, polyolefin synthetic pulp will remain a key material in these sectors.
Polyolefin synthetic pulp has made significant inroads in the industrial materials sector due to its unique combination of strength, flexibility, and resistance to environmental factors. It is utilized in the production of industrial packaging materials, including protective wraps, filters, and insulation. The material's lightweight properties and ability to absorb impact make it ideal for creating robust, yet cost-effective solutions for industrial goods that require protection during transit. Additionally, its high resistance to chemicals and moisture enables it to withstand harsh conditions commonly encountered in industrial environments.Polyolefin synthetic pulp is also increasingly used in filtration applications, where it is used to manufacture filters that purify air, water, and other industrial substances. Its capacity to be engineered for a variety of filtration tasks makes it an ideal choice for industries such as oil and gas, pharmaceuticals, and environmental control. As industries continue to evolve toward more sustainable, efficient, and resilient production methods, the demand for polyolefin synthetic pulp in industrial materials is expected to rise.
